Summary
Top KingWin Ltd announced the closing of the sale of its indirect subsidiary for $218,100 in cash, a transaction previously disclosed in May.

Subsidiary Disposition Closed
Top KingWin Ltd's indirect subsidiary, Sky KingWin (HK) Limited, completed the sale of its wholly-owned subsidiary, Guangdong Tiancheng Jinhui Enterprise Development Group Co., Ltd.
-
Cash Consideration Received
The company received $218,100 in cash from Junze Management Co., Limited for the disposition.
-
Follows Prior Disclosure
This closing follows the initial agreement disclosure on May 21, 2026, which was reported in a 6-K filing on May 22, 2026.
